文档索引
在以下地址获取完整文档索引:https://code.claude.com/docs/llms.txt 使用此文件发现所有可用页面,然后再进一步探索。
企业部署概述
了解 Claude Code 如何与各种第三方服务和基础设施集成,以满足企业部署需求。
组织可以直接通过 Anthropic 或通过云提供商部署 Claude Code。本页帮助您选择正确的配置。
比较部署选项
对于大多数组织,Claude for Teams 或 Claude for Enterprise 提供最佳体验。团队成员通过单一订阅即可访问 Claude Code 和网页版 Claude,集中计费,无需基础设施设置。
Claude for Teams 是自助服务,包含协作功能、管理工具和计费管理。最适合需要快速上手的小型团队。
Claude for Enterprise 增加了 SSO 和域名捕获、基于角色的权限、合规 API 访问以及用于在组织范围内部署 Claude Code 配置的托管策略设置。最适合有安全和合规需求的大型组织。
如果您的组织有特定的基础设施需求,请比较以下选项:
| 功能 | Claude for Teams/Enterprise | Anthropic Console | Amazon Bedrock | AWS 上的 Claude 平台 | Google Vertex AI | Microsoft Foundry |
|---|---|---|---|---|---|---|
| 最适合 | 大多数组织(推荐) | 个人开发者 | AWS 原生部署 | AWS Marketplace 计费配合 Claude API 功能 | GCP 原生部署 | Azure 原生部署 |
| 计费 | 团队: $150/席位(高级版)提供按量付费 企业: 联系销售 | 按量付费 | 通过 AWS 按量付费 | 通过 AWS Marketplace 按量付费 | 通过 GCP 按量付费 | 通过 Azure 按量付费 |
| 区域 | 支持的国家/地区 | 支持的国家/地区 | 多个 AWS 区域 | 多个 AWS 区域 | 多个 GCP 区域 | 多个 Azure 区域 |
| 提示缓存 | 默认启用 | 默认启用 | 默认启用 | 默认启用 | 默认启用 | 默认启用 |
| 认证 | Claude.ai SSO 或邮箱 | API 密钥 | API 密钥或 AWS 凭证 | API 密钥或 AWS 凭证 | GCP 凭证 | API 密钥或 Microsoft Entra ID |
| 成本跟踪 | 使用量仪表板 | 使用量仪表板 | AWS Cost Explorer | AWS Cost Explorer | GCP Billing | Azure Cost Management |
| 包含网页版 Claude | 是 | 否 | 否 | 否 | 否 | 否 |
| 企业功能 | 团队管理、SSO、使用量监控 | 无 | IAM 策略、CloudTrail | IAM 策略、CloudTrail | IAM 角色、Cloud Audit Logs | RBAC 策略、Azure Monitor |
选择部署选项以查看设置说明:
- Claude for Teams 或 Enterprise
- Anthropic Console
- Amazon Bedrock
- AWS 上的 Claude 平台
- Google Vertex AI
- Microsoft Foundry
配置代理和网关
大多数组织可以直接使用云提供商而无需额外配置。但是,如果您的组织有特定的网络或管理需求,您可能需要配置企业代理或 LLM 网关。这些是可以一起使用的不同配置:
- 企业代理:通过 HTTP/HTTPS 代理路由流量。如果您的组织要求所有出站流量通过代理服务器进行安全监控、合规或网络策略执行,请使用此选项。使用
HTTPS_PROXY或HTTP_PROXY环境变量配置。在企业网络配置中了解更多。 - LLM 网关:位于 Claude Code 和云提供商之间处理认证和路由的服务。如果您需要跨团队的集中使用量跟踪、自定义速率限制或预算,或集中认证管理,请使用此选项。使用
ANTHROPIC_BASE_URL、ANTHROPIC_BEDROCK_BASE_URL、ANTHROPIC_AWS_BASE_URL或ANTHROPIC_VERTEX_BASE_URL环境变量配置。在 LLM 网关配置中了解更多。
以下示例显示了在 shell 或 shell 配置文件(.bashrc、.zshrc)中设置的环境变量。有关其他配置方法,请参阅设置。
Amazon Bedrock
通过设置以下环境变量,将 Bedrock 流量通过企业代理路由:
# 启用 Bedrock
export CLAUDE_CODE_USE_BEDROCK=1
export AWS_REGION=us-east-1
# 配置企业代理
export HTTPS_PROXY='https://proxy.example.com:8080'
通过设置以下环境变量,将 Bedrock 流量通过 LLM 网关路由:
# 启用 Bedrock
export CLAUDE_CODE_USE_BEDROCK=1
# 配置 LLM 网关
export ANTHROPIC_BEDROCK_BASE_URL='https://your-llm-gateway.com/bedrock'
export CLAUDE_CODE_SKIP_BEDROCK_AUTH=1 # 如果网关处理 AWS 认证
Microsoft Foundry
通过设置以下环境变量,将 Foundry 流量通过企业代理路由:
# 启用 Microsoft Foundry
export CLAUDE_CODE_USE_FOUNDRY=1
export ANTHROPIC_FOUNDRY_RESOURCE=your-resource
export ANTHROPIC_FOUNDRY_API_KEY=your-api-key # 或省略以使用 Entra ID 认证
# 配置企业代理
export HTTPS_PROXY='https://proxy.example.com:8080'
通过设置以下环境变量,将 Foundry 流量通过 LLM 网关路由:
# 启用 Microsoft Foundry
export CLAUDE_CODE_USE_FOUNDRY=1
# 配置 LLM 网关
export ANTHROPIC_FOUNDRY_BASE_URL='https://your-llm-gateway.com'
export CLAUDE_CODE_SKIP_FOUNDRY_AUTH=1 # 如果网关处理 Azure 认证
Google Vertex AI
通过设置以下环境变量,将 Vertex AI 流量通过企业代理路由:
# 启用 Vertex
export CLAUDE_CODE_USE_VERTEX=1
export CLOUD_ML_REGION=us-east5
export ANTHROPIC_VERTEX_PROJECT_ID=your-project-id
# 配置企业代理
export HTTPS_PROXY='https://proxy.example.com:8080'
通过设置以下环境变量,将 Vertex AI 流量通过 LLM 网关路由:
# 启用 Vertex
export CLAUDE_CODE_USE_VERTEX=1
# 配置 LLM 网关
export ANTHROPIC_VERTEX_BASE_URL='https://your-llm-gateway.com/vertex'
export CLAUDE_CODE_SKIP_VERTEX_AUTH=1 # 如果网关处理 GCP 认证
在 Claude Code 中使用 /status 验证代理和网关配置是否正确应用。
组织最佳实践
投资文档和记忆
我们强烈建议投资文档,以便 Claude Code 理解您的代码库。组织可以在多个级别部署 CLAUDE.md 文件:
- 组织范围:部署到系统目录,如
/Library/Application Support/ClaudeCode/CLAUDE.md(macOS),用于公司范围的标准 - 仓库级别:在仓库根目录创建
CLAUDE.md文件,包含项目架构、构建命令和贡献指南。将这些纳入版本控制,以便所有用户受益
在记忆和 CLAUDE.md 文件中了解更多。
简化部署
如果您有自定义开发环境,我们发现创建"一键"安装 Claude Code 的方式是扩大组织采用率的关键。
从引导式使用开始
鼓励新用户尝试 Claude Code 进行代码库问答,或用于较小的错误修复或功能请求。让 Claude Code 制定计划。检查 Claude 的建议,如果偏离方向请给予反馈。随着时间推移,随着用户更好地理解这种新范式,他们会更有效地让 Claude Code 以更具代理性的方式运行。
为云提供商固定模型版本
如果您通过 Bedrock、Vertex AI、Foundry 或 AWS 上的 Claude 平台部署,请使用 ANTHROPIC_DEFAULT_OPUS_MODEL、ANTHROPIC_DEFAULT_SONNET_MODEL 和 ANTHROPIC_DEFAULT_HAIKU_MODEL 固定特定模型版本。不固定的话,模型别名会解析为最新版本,当 Anthropic 发布更新时,该版本可能尚未在您的账户中启用。固定版本可以让您控制用户何时迁移到新模型。有关每个提供商在最新版本不可用时的行为,请参阅模型配置。
配置安全策略
安全团队可以配置托管权限来定义 Claude Code 允许和不允许执行的操作,这些不能被本地配置覆盖。了解更多。
利用 MCP 进行集成
MCP 是为 Claude Code 提供更多信息的好方法,例如连接到工单管理系统或错误日志。我们建议一个中央团队配置 MCP 服务器并将 .mcp.json 配置检入代码库,以便所有用户受益。了解更多。
在 Anthropic,我们信任 Claude Code 为每个 Anthropic 代码库提供开发支持。希望您像我们一样享受使用 Claude Code。
后续步骤
选择部署选项并为团队配置访问权限后:
- 向团队推广:分享安装说明,让团队成员安装 Claude Code 并使用其凭证进行认证。
- 设置共享配置:在仓库中创建 CLAUDE.md 文件,帮助 Claude Code 理解您的代码库和编码标准。
- 配置权限:查看安全设置以定义 Claude Code 在您的环境中可以和不可以执行的操作。